COOK TIME
8 to 11 lb (4 to 5 kg) ROASTS:
8 minutes per pound for the first roast
(18 minutes per kilogram) plus add 10
minutes for each additional roast.
12 lb (5 kg) ROASTS:
10 minutes per pound for the first roast
(22 minutes per kilogram) plus add 10
minutes for each additional roast.
14 lb (6 kg) roasts:
10 minutes per pound for the first roast
(22 minutes per kilogram) plus add 15
minutes for each additional roast.
15 to 23 lb (7 to 10kg) roasts:
10 minutes per pound for the first roast
(22 minutes per kilogram) plus add 30
minutes for each additional roast.
40 to 49 lb (18 to 22 kg) ROASTS:
10 minutes per pound for the first roast
(22 minutes per kilogram) plus add 15
minutes for a second roast.
50 to 80 lb (23 to 36 kg) ROASTS:
one roast only — 7 minutes per pound
(15 minutes per kilogram)

Do not overload the oven. When cooking these large roasts,
reinforce the shelf support by using two
wire shelves in one shelf bracket.
The time and temperature are suggested guidelines only. All cooking should be based on internal product temperatures. Due to
variations in product quality, weight and desired degree of doneness, the cooking time may need to be adjusted accordingly. Always
follow local health (hygiene) regulations for all internal temperature requirements.
